In this video, we will explain how the Radius of protection is calculated with the formula and with the help of our table! 🌩️ What is an ESE Lightning Arrester? Also known as Early Streamer Emission Lightning Arrester, this technology is designed to protect structures from direct lightning strikes. It enhances the Radius of Protection, thereby reducing the number of Lightning Arresters and Down Conductors required for comprehensive protection. Yet, it provides complete protection. It protects by ensuring that the lightning bolts are safely channelled. Instead of striking random objects, the lightning is directed through the ESE lightning arrester. From there, the high-voltage surges are dissipated into the ground safely. 📐 What is a Lightning Arrester's Coverage Area? The coverage area is the spatial region within which the arrester can effectively protect a structure from lightning strikes. It is represented as a semicircle with a specific radius of protection (Rp).
